什么软件能做服务器

不及物动词 其他 38

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建一个服务器,可以使用多种软件来实现,以下是一些常用的服务器软件:

    1. Apache HTTP Server:这是一个开源的Web服务器软件,被广泛使用。它支持多种操作系统,如Windows、Linux、Mac等。Apache被认为是最常用的Web服务器软件之一,它提供了稳定、安全、可靠的Web服务。

    2. Nginx:Nginx也是一个常用的开源Web服务器软件,与Apache相比,它在处理高并发请求方面表现更加优秀。Nginx常用于大型网站、高流量网站或负载均衡的服务器搭建。

    3. Microsoft Internet Information Services(IIS):这是微软的Web服务器软件,它仅适用于Windows操作系统。IIS拥有良好的集成性能,可以与其他微软的服务(如Active Directory)无缝集成,适用于搭建Microsoft技术栈的服务器。

    4. Tomcat:这是Apache基金会的另一个开源项目,是一个用于Java应用程序的Web服务器软件。Tomcat是一个Java Servlet容器,用于在Java环境中运行Java Servlet和JavaServer Pages(JSP)。它适合搭建Java Web应用程序的服务器。

    5. MySQL/MariaDB/PostgreSQL:这些是常见的关系型数据库服务器软件,用于存储和管理数据。MySQL、MariaDB和PostgreSQL都是开源软件,提供了高性能、稳定可靠的数据库服务。

    6. OpenSSH:这是一个开源的安全Shell和加密传输软件,用于远程登录和安全文件传输。OpenSSH可以用于搭建安全的远程服务器,保护数据的传输和访问安全。

    除了上述软件,还有许多其他服务器软件可供选择,例如FTP服务器软件、邮件服务器软件、DNS服务器软件等。选择适合你需求的服务器软件,可以根据你的操作系统、编程语言和功能需求来决定。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    有很多软件可以用于搭建服务器,以下是其中一些常用的软件:

    1. Apache HTTP Server:Apache是一个开源的Web服务器软件,广泛用于互联网上的服务器。它支持多种操作系统,并且易于配置和管理。 Apache是目前最流行的Web服务器之一,可以用于托管静态网页、动态网页和应用程序等。

    2. Nginx:Nginx是一个高性能、高并发的Web服务器。它具有较低的内存消耗和高效的处理请求能力,被广泛应用于大规模网站和高流量应用。Nginx也支持反向代理、负载均衡和高可用性等功能。

    3. Microsoft Internet Information Services (IIS):IIS是微软开发的一种Web服务器软件,适用于Windows操作系统。它集成在Windows Server操作系统中,默认配置简单,适合搭建中小型网站和应用程序。

    4. Tomcat:Tomcat是一个开源的Java Servlet容器,也可以用作独立的Web服务器。它支持Java Servlet和JavaServer Pages (JSP) 技术,适用于托管Java Web应用程序。

    5. Node.js:Node.js是一个基于Chrome V8引擎的JavaScript运行环境。它可以用于构建高性能的网络应用和服务器。Node.js的特点是单线程、非阻塞I/O和事件驱动,适合处理大量并发请求。

    除了上述软件之外,还有许多其他的软件可以用于搭建服务器,如Lighttpd、Jboss、GlassFish等。选择适合自己需求的服务器软件,需要考虑操作系统兼容性、性能要求、安全性以及所需功能等因素。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    有很多不同的软件可以用来搭建服务器,以下是一些常用的服务器软件:

    1. Apache HTTP Server:Apache是一款开源的Web服务器软件,可在Linux、Unix和Windows等操作系统上运行。它功能强大、稳定性高,并且具有良好的可扩展性。安装和配置Apache服务器相对简单,支持多种编程语言和模块。

    2. Nginx:Nginx也是一款开源的Web服务器软件,它的特点是高并发和低内存消耗。Nginx通常用作反向代理服务器,可以将请求转发给不同的后端服务器。它也可以用来提供静态文件的服务,如图片、CSS和JavaScript等。

    3. Microsoft Internet Information Services(IIS):IIS是由微软开发的服务器软件,主要用于Windows操作系统。作为Windows Server的一部分,IIS提供了强大的功能和安全性,适用于托管ASP.NET和其他Microsoft Web技术的网站。

    4. Tomcat:Tomcat是一款基于Java的Web服务器软件,用于执行Java Servlet和JavaServer Pages(JSP)等动态网页。它可以独立运行,也可以与Apache HTTP Server等配合使用。Tomcat适用于开发和部署Java Web应用程序。

    5. Lighttpd:Lighttpd是一款轻量级的Web服务器软件,它使用C语言编写,占用系统资源较少。Lighttpd支持FastCGI、CGI和SSL等多种功能,适用于高性能和低负载的服务器环境。

    除了上述软件,还有其他一些用于特定用途的服务器软件,如邮件服务器(如Postfix和Exim)、数据库服务器(如MySQL和PostgreSQL)以及文件服务器(如Samba和FTP服务器)。选择适合自己需求的服务器软件需要考虑操作系统、性能需求、安全性和可扩展性等因素。在选择和配置服务器软件时,需要仔细阅读官方文档,并根据实际情况进行设置和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部